Abstract
We explore the possibility for generalized electromagnetism on flat spacetime. For a single copy of U(1) gauge theory, we show that the Galileon-type generalization of electromagnetism is forbidden. Given that the equations of motion for the vector field are gauge invariant and Lorentz invariant, follow from an action and contain no more than second derivative on A μ, the equations of motion are at most linear with respect to second derivative of A μ .
